Handover note — cleaning-crew access (for new starters)

Welcome aboard. The Tidewell cleaning crew comes Mondays and Thursdays after 19:00. They sign the log at reception and you tick their names against the roster kept in the top drawer. They clean floors 1–3 only; the Harlowe Wing is off-limits without a supervisor. If they arrive before reception closes, just buzz them through. If they arrive after, they'll ask you for the service entrance code, which is the following.

door code, tagef-bajop: bdg-SB-7

Subject: DR drill results — Mosswick sweeper

Team,

Thursday's drill went fine. We failed the Mosswick retention sweeper over to the standby region in 11 minutes; no retention windows were missed. One gap: the standby console prompts for the sweeper recovery passphrase and nobody had it handy. Capturing it here ahead of the sync so we're covered next time:

strongbox words: wenix-ulador

During the Larkspur Expo, Mireva Systems runs a pop-up office at Hall 4 of the Brentmoor Fairgrounds. Visitors are fine during show hours, but after 18:00 only badged staff and pre-cleared contractors get in — facilities, please check names against the expo roster before unlocking anything. The cabin door has a keypad; the code for this week is below.

door code, kahap-kawip: bdg-XUDDCY-22034334